#053bb6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#053bb6 is composed of 2% red, 23.1%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 221.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 36.7%. #053bb6 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a76ff with #00006d.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#053bb6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030a is the darkest color, while #f6f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#053bb6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5d60 is the less saturated color, while #053bb6 is the most saturated one.
